Located in the Cool Mountains of Arizona We call this cabin "The Bunk House". It is nestled in the tall pines of northern Arizona, just off a stretch of the historic Route 66 and is a campers dream vacation. It is an hours drive to the the Grand Canyon, 25 minutes west of Flagstaff, & 45 minutes north of Sedona. The adjacent one room log cabin, which has a queen bed & private 1/2 bath, is an additional charge. Within "whisteling" distance of the Bunk House.

Elk hunters, we are in area 7 west. In the summer there is a herd of bull Elk that come right onto the property. If you like to fish you are close to 4 lakes. If you like to hike you don't have far to go. The mountains are right here. The elk, deer, fox, raccoons, & coyotes make the best neighbors.

The Bunk House is a rural cabin and has no stove. Most cooking is done outdoors. We do however provide a refrigerator, microwave, convection oven, coffee maker & BBQ grill. You probably won't have time to care but there is a TV & DVD player. Mother nature provides the well known Arizona sunset & serenity. Toaster oven and crock pot are available upon request.

Whether you are visiting the Grand Canyon, planning a vacation in the pines, you are a skier, a hunter, a fisherman, a camper that doesn't want to have to sleep in a tent, a Route 66 fan, or just want some fresh air, this cabin is in an ideal spot.

The Grand Canyon Railway out of Williams is an excellent way to see the canyon & only a 15 min drive. The cabin is located between Flagstaff & Williams. It is on private property but the Kaibab National Forest is on the north & east sides. Ideal for hunting, hiking, or playing in the snow. The San Francisco Peaks & Snow bowl are a must see even in the summer. Nearby is a large lava tube which is one of the areas best kept secrets. Plan an entire day for the Grand Canyon, another day for the ski lift at Snow Bowl or a Route 66 day in Flagstaff & Williams. The Polar Express, sponsored by, the Grand Canyon Railway is a great way for little ones to see the canyon during the Christmas Holidays. The Cabin is within walking distance of the old Parks historical country store. Built in the 1930's out of railroad ties milled in Flagstaff, The Bunk House has plenty of character. Nothing fancy, just peaceful & comfortable. This is a non-smoking cabin as per our county laws.
